What country was first inhabited by the Taino, and Cuboney?

The country that was first inhabited by the Taino and Cuboney people was Hispaniola. Hispaniola is an island in the Caribbean, which is now divided into the countries of Haiti and the Dominican Republic.

Christopher Columbus arrived on the island in 1492 and mistakenly thought he had reached Asia. The Spanish quickly dominated the local people, and the island became a Spanish colony.

It is estimated that the Taino population on Hispaniola was around three million when the Spanish arrived, but due to Spanish colonization, warfare, and disease, the population declined significantly.
